In der modernen Webentwicklung ist die Kombination von CSS und PHP zum Schlüssel zur Verbesserung der Benutzererfahrung und der Leistung der Website geworden. Das Verständnis des Kollaborationsmechanismus zwischen den beiden hilft Entwicklern, effizientere und personalisierte dynamische Webanwendungen aufzubauen und aufrechtzuerhalten. In diesem Artikel wird eingehende Möglichkeiten zum Kombinieren von CSS und PHP untersucht und praktische Entwicklungstechniken ausgetauscht, um die Projektleistung zu optimieren.
CSS ist hauptsächlich für die visuelle Anzeige von Webseiten verantwortlich, während PHP die Logik und Daten auf der Serverseite verarbeitet. Durch die Kombination der beiden können Entwickler dynamisch Stile und Inhalte generieren, um die personalisierten Bedürfnisse zu erfüllen. Beispielsweise kann PHP CSS -Klassen dynamisch anhand der Benutzereingaben anpassen, um angepasste Seiteneffekte zu erzielen.
Mit Hilfe von PHP können CSS -Stile dynamisch generiert werden und Benutzer können nach verschiedenen Geschäftsszenarien ein einzigartiges Erlebnis bieten. Das folgende Beispiel zeigt, wie dynamische CSS -Stile über PHP ausgegeben werden:
$color = "blue"; // Nutzen Sie Wert aus Datenbank oder Benutzereingabe
echo "body {\n color: $color;\n}\n";
Wenn der Benutzer eine andere Farbe auswählt, generiert PHP den entsprechenden Stil dynamisch, sodass der Webseiteninhalt personalisierter wird. Diese Methode verbessert nicht nur die Benutzererfahrung, sondern verbessert auch die visuelle Attraktivität der Seite.
Manchmal müssen Sie Elemente basierend auf Bedingungen dynamisch CSS -Klassen hinzufügen, die durch konditionelle PHP -Aussagen implementiert werden können. Beispiele sind wie folgt:
$status = "active"; // Angenommen, der Staat stammt aus der Datenbank
$class = ($status == "active") ? "btn-active" : "btn-inactive";
// existierenHTMLVerwenden Sie dies in$classVariable
Obwohl dynamische und Inline -Stile flexibel sind, entspricht die Externalisierung von CSS -Stilen zu eigenständigen Dateien eher den Entwicklungsspezifikationen. PHP kann einfach Stildateien am Kopf der Seite einführen:
<link rel="stylesheet" type="text/css" href="styles.css">
Durch die vernünftige Kombination der dynamischen Wechselwirkung zwischen CSS und PHP können Entwickler die Personalisierung und Reaktionsgeschwindigkeit von Webseiten erheblich verbessern. Clear Code-Struktur und flexible Stilverwaltung sind der Schlüssel zum Aufbau hochwertiger Webanwendungen. Ich hoffe, der Inhalt dieses Artikels hilft Ihnen dabei, Ihr Verständnis zu vertiefen, Ihre Entwicklungsfähigkeiten zu verbessern und eine attraktivere dynamische Website in tatsächlichen Projekten zu erstellen.